Rebecca Janzen is a PhD candidate at the University of Toronto, is working on a dissertation titled “Collective Bodies: Reading Oppression and Resistance in 20th Century Mexican Literature” that examines representations of the body, religion and land in a novels and short stories. She has won several awards and scholarships, including the Canadian Association of Hispanists’ Best Graduate Essay Award and an Ontario Graduate Scholarship. She holds a Secretaría de Relaciones Exteriores (México) Grant to conduct doctoral research at the Universidad Autónoma Metropolitana – Azcapotzalco in Fall 2012.
